Korok Frond

Korok Fronds are recurring Items in The Legend of Zelda series.(TotKTears of the Kingdom | AoIAge of Imprisonment)[1][2]

Description
A mysterious leaf that looks like it might be hiding something behind it. It has some medicinal value. Attach it to a stick and it can be used as a fan.

Properties
Fuse Atk: 1

Korok Fronds are Materials that can be Fused with Arrows. It is unknown what effect this imbues onto Arrows, but a green swirl is shown encircling Arrows when drawn. Korok Fronds can be consumed to restore Link's Life Gauge.

Korok Fronds can be used as Herbs in a Cooking Pot to make the following Meals:
